| Arbitration Approach: |
Arbitrations are formal and I take an active role in the process, if required to resolve material issues. Formal briefing is required with simultaneous exchange of briefs and supporting documentary evidence three days before the arbitration. Arbitration awards are accompanied with a formal and detailed statement of decision. |
